In the early 1990s, China began importing tons of cassettes and CDs from the record industries in the United States and Canada. It was surpluses that would end up in recycling plants. To prevent them from being consumed as what they were — music — they had previously passed through an electric saw.
Dakou (打 口) in Chinese means "to make breaks or openings" and was the name given to these ribbons cut or sometimes completely destroyed. Against this background, an underground channel for the commercialization of repaired tapes emerged, outside the arid debate of illegality.
